Subject: [gentoo-dev] Base system requirements

Heres a rough list to begin with:
Known stable kernel
One Bourne compatible shell
libc (glibc/dietlibc/uclibc/...., glibc preferred)
Anything that supports connecting to a network (dhcpcd, route, ifconfig,
pppoe, pppd).
Python (for emerge)
ssh
rsync
cvs
filesystem utils
package utils (tar, bzip2, gzip, md5sum, gpg)
manuals (man/info pages)
Enabled by default, but optionally rejectable:
C/C++ compiler
Perl
sshd
One MTA (Postfix preferred/Exim as a second choice for the default MTA).
a browser (lynx/links)
uuencode/uudecode
